Definitions

rotatornoun
A device or mechanism that causes something to rotate or turn.
The engineer installed a rotator to ensure the satellite dish could adjust its position for better signal reception.
A muscle that causes or assists in the rotation of a part of the body.
The rotator cuff is a group of muscles and tendons that stabilize the shoulder.
rotatoradjective
Relating to or involved in rotation, especially describing a device, mechanism, or anatomical part that rotates or causes rotation.
The technician inspected the rotator assembly for signs of wear.
